What companies run services between Calais, France and Catacombs of Paris, France?

You can take a train from Calais Ville to Catacombs of Paris via Lille Flandres, Paris Nord, and Denfert-Rochereau in around 3h 31m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Calais to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ine) 5 times a day. Tickets cost €24–35 and the journey takes 3h 40m.
